In the past two weeks we’ve kicked three lies in the boo-tay!  Quick recap…

 

Lie #1

We cannot define Who We Are based on our opinion of ourselves.

prcas1468

Lie #2

We cannot define Who We Are based on the opinions others have of us.

 

Lie #3

We cannot define Who We Are based on the occurrences or circumstances that surround our life.

And now the moment of truth…what we’ve been waiting for.

 

There is only one way to frame the answer to the question “Who Am I?”  and it’s by asking God what HE thinks of us.

 

Who we are has nothing to do with:

  • how we see ourselves
  • how others see us
  • or our life’s circumstances.

But let’s not settle for mere DoAhead dialogue.

 

Paul says in Romans Chapter 12, “The only accurate way to understand ourselves is by what God is and what He does for us, not by what we are and what we do for Him.”

 

And now the incredible news. Guess how He sees us?!

 

“I’ll call them nobodies and make the somebody’s; I’ll call the unloved and make them beloved.”  Romans 9:25

 

“Listen, O daughter, consider and give ear: Forget your people and your father’s house. The king is enthralled by your beauty; honor him, for he is your lord.” Psalm 45:10-11 

 

How humbling!  The God of the  Universe calls us beloved.  He is enthralled by our beauty, “the King is wild for us.”
